- Description
-
One of a pair of large blue and white dishes, Kangxi period, each freely painted in the central roundel with a pair of warriors on horseback and two foot soldiers bearing flags in simple landscape of rockwork and a single tree, the rim with six petal-shaped panels, each filled with boldly painted warrior on a galloping horse with a foot soldier following close behind and with alternating diaper between panels, the reverse with flower sprays above a large ruyi head, the base with six character Chenghua mark in underglaze blue.
- Inscription(s)
-
(From appraisal by J.J. Lally, 24 February 1992) The base with six character Chenghua mark in underglaze blue.
